Nanny

Vacancy Description

Family Description and Location 
A warm and welcoming ultra-high-net-worth (UHNW) family are looking for an experienced, professional Nanny to join their household on a long-term basis. They have two children aged 2, 5 and an older child. They are based in a  beautiful area  in Nottinghamshire. You’ll be working alongside other household staff, including a housekeeper and a gardener.
This is a fantastic opportunity for someone who truly enjoys working with children and is looking to become a valued part of a family.

Job Description 
This is a live-in role with lovely private accommodation provided. Your main focus will be caring for the two younger children, while also supporting the older child with their routine and homework as needed.
Your day-to-day duties will include:

  • Following and adapting daily routines as the children grow
  • Creating a safe, happy and nurturing environment
  • Organising fun activities and playdates
  • Helping with hygiene routines
  • Scheduling and attending appointments (medical, educational, etc.)
  • Liaising with teachers and childcare professionals
  • Supporting the children’s nutrition and preparing some meals
  • Light housekeeping and nursery duties
  • Assisting with homework (particularly Years 7–9 level)

This family does travel, so you’ll need to be open to joining them on trips around the UK and abroad
When the family is in residence, flexibility is key — including some weekend work (with time off given in return).

Candidate Requirements
 
The ideal candidate will be:

  • Warm, professional and looking to commit long-term
  • Experienced with children of different ages, especially toddlers and early teens
  • Confident in speaking English, with excellent communication skills
  • Knowledgeable about early years development and education
  • Comfortable helping with schoolwork (especially KS3 level)
  • Proactive, flexible and team-oriented
  • A good cook with an interest in children’s nutrition
  • Open to travel and confident managing children on the go
  • A driver is a bonus, but not essential

Strong references and a great work history are a must.
 

Days of Work, Accommodation and Salary

  • Schedule: 5 days per week (Monday to Friday), mainly covering mornings and evenings with breaks during the day; weekend flexibility needed when the family is home
  • Hours: Around 55 hours per week
  • Accommodation: Private, semi self-contained living space within the estate
  • Travel: Yes – UK and international travel included
  • Salary: £700–£900 gross per week (more for the right candidate)
  • Start: As soon as possible, or happy to wait for the right fit
